Key Responsibilities
  • Develop, implement, and manage customized physical therapy treatment plans aimed at enhancing patient mobility and functionality.
  • Conduct thorough evaluations of patients' physical capabilities, utilizing diagnostic assessments that focus on muscle, nerve, joint, and functional performance.
  • Administer a range of therapeutic exercises, both manual and non-manual, while also guiding and motivating clients through recovery activities.
  • Implement pain-relief techniques through physical modalities such as traction, massage, and various physical agents based on individual patient needs.
  • Assess, fit, and optimize prosthetic and orthotic devices, ensuring proper adjustments and recommendations to enhance clients' rehabilitation and daily living.
  • Provide education and training to patients and families on health management practices and injury prevention strategies.

Qualifications
  • A Master's Degree or Doctorate in Physical Therapy from an accredited institution.
  • An active physical therapy license in the state of Florida.
  • A minimum of two years of clinical experience, specifically in orthopedic settings.
  • Knowledge and proficiency in orthopedic assessments, treatment planning, and evidence-based patient care approaches.
  • Exceptional communication and organization skills, with the ability to foster strong therapeutic relationships with patients.
  • Experience working with electronic medical records (EMR) systems to document patient progress and manage treatment plans effectively.
